CNBLUE Kang Min Hyuk & Lee Jong Hyun - 50% Viewing Rate Combined!

Male idol group CNBLUE members Kang Min Hyuk and Lee Jong Hyun have successfully transformed into actors. Combining the dramas they appear in, they hit an incredible high of a 50% viewing rate.

Kang Min Hyuk is currently starring in the KBS drama "Unexpected You" and Lee Jong Hyun stars in the SBS drama "A Gentleman's Dignity." On June 17, the two dramas received a 36.2% and 16.6% viewing rate. Together, they had a viewing rate of 52.8%! 

Two members of CNBLUE are starring in two of the hottest dramas of the season. Kang Min Hyuk began his acting career in 2010 in the drama "It's Okay, Daddy's Girl" followed by "Heartstrings." In the current drama Kang Min Hyuk is working on, he appears as Kim Nam Joo's little brother, Cha Se Kwang, who is often referred to as 'mental shock Se Kwang', 'cold Se Kwang' and 'Sudden Se Kwang'. Kang Min Hyuk's character is loved for his various personalities.

Kang Min Hyuk also has a love line with Bang Mal Sook (Oh Yeon Seo) in "Unexpectedly You." On the episode that was aired on the June 17, feature Mal Sook finding out that Se Kwang is Yoon Hee's (Kim Nam Joo) little brother and freaking out.

While Kang Min Hyuk is the center of attention in the drama "Unexpectedly You," Lee Jong Hyun plays a mysterious role named Collin in the drama "A Gentleman's Dignity." Lee Jong Hyun and Kang Min Hyuk appeared in the movie "Acoustic," which was their first acting role in a movie. His appearance in "A Gentleman's Dignity" is Lee Jong Hyun's first acting role in a drama.

Although they began their careers as singers, they are praised for their acting skills in the dramas they are currently appearing in for their impressive performances.
